How GST is Calculated — Inclusive, Exclusive, and the CGST/SGST Split

Understand GST calculation for invoicing. Learn the difference between inclusive and exclusive pricing, how CGST/SGST works, and how to extract tax from an MRP.

GST (Goods and Services Tax) replaced a dozen indirect taxes in India with a single unified system. Whether you’re a freelancer issuing invoices or a shopper checking if the MRP includes tax — understanding GST math is essential.

Two scenarios

GST Exclusive (adding tax): You know the base price, and need to add GST on top.

GST Amount = Base Price × (Rate / 100)
Total = Base Price + GST Amount

GST Inclusive (extracting tax): You know the total (MRP), and need to find the base price.

Base Price = Total / (1 + Rate/100)
GST Amount = Total − Base Price

Worked example

A ₹10,000 service at 18% GST:

Exclusive: GST = ₹10,000 × 0.18 = ₹1,800 → Total = ₹11,800
Inclusive: Base = ₹10,000 / 1.18 = ₹8,475 → GST = ₹1,525

CGST and SGST

For intra-state transactions (buyer and seller in same state), GST is split equally:

  • CGST (Central) = GST / 2
  • SGST (State) = GST / 2

For inter-state transactions, the full rate is charged as IGST.

So ₹1,800 GST on an intra-state sale = ₹900 CGST + ₹900 SGST.

GST slab rates in India

RateApplies to
0%Essential food items, healthcare
5%Basic necessities, economy travel
12%Processed food, business class
18%Most services, electronics
28%Luxury goods, automobiles, sin goods

Common mistakes

  • Applying GST on already-inclusive MRP (double taxation)
  • Confusing IGST with CGST+SGST on invoices
  • Not reverse-calculating base price for tax credit claims

TL;DR

  • Exclusive: add rate% on top. Inclusive: divide by (1 + rate%)
  • CGST + SGST for intra-state; IGST for inter-state
  • Most services are 18%; luxury goods are 28%
  • Always clarify if a quoted price includes or excludes GST
